
Sales Executive
Freudenberg Filtration Technologies, Hopkinsville, KY, United States
Overview
Working at Freudenberg: "We will wow your world!" This is our promise. As a global technology group, we not only make the world cleaner, healthier and more comfortable, but also offer our 52,000 employees a networked and diverse environment where everyone can thrive individually. Be surprised and experience your own wow moments. Protecting people and the environment, and optimizing industrial processes - that is what drives us at Freudenberg Filtration Technologies. We serve our automotive, consumer goods and industrial customers with technically leading products, system solutions, services and consulting in air and liquid filtration. As part of the Freudenberg Group, strong corporate values guide us in our aspiration for innovation, efficiency and highest customer focus. With a dedicated team of around 3,500 colleagues, we generate an annual turnover of about 670 million euros.

Responsibilities
Lead initiatives in the US to grow product sales in the OE automotive industry and Autobody Refinish market
Support distributors on end user applications and expanding the existing footprint
Recommend product portfolio requirements for growth, and gain internal acceptance and action via compiled business assessments, voice of the customer and presentations
Achieve territory sales and profitability goals provided by Market Segment Manager
Support Company business objectives, goals and plans and provide leadership within scope of responsibility to meet and exceed expectations
Qualifications
A minimum of three years of work experience in industrial or automotive OE surface finishing application environments
Bachelor’s degree in engineering, business, marketing, or a related field
Negotiation and contract management skills
Experience in paint related environments; Tier 1 and OEM manufacturers
Understanding of basic OEM paint operations; E-Coat, Primer, Top Coat, and Ovens, Dirt in Paint or Defect analysis, and General knowledge of Autobody Refinish market
